Refreshing and Soothing “Mikan Rare Cheese Pancakes”

For those of you feeling a little worn out from the heat wave. We’ve cooled down some freshly baked pancakes and topped them with cream cheese and mandarin oranges to create a refreshing cold dessert. It looks just like a little cake. It’s a refreshing treat that’s perfect as a reward for all your hard work.

Ingredients

Material Name Quantity Notes
Pancake Mix 100 g Store-bought is fine
Eggs 1 piece
Milk 80 ml
Mandarins (canned, etc.) 1 can We recommend the syrup-soaked ones
Cream Cheese 50 g Bring to room temperature
Sugar 1 tablespoon
Mint Leaves A little For decoration

*Approximate calories per serving: about 350 kcal

How to Make It

[Step 1] In a bowl, mix the eggs and milk, then add the pancake mix and stir until smooth.
[Step 2] Heat a frying pan over low heat, cook a few small pancakes, and let them cool completely on a wire rack.
[Step 3] In a separate bowl, beat the cream cheese until smooth, then add sugar and a little syrup.
[Step 4] Spread the cream on the cooled pancakes, top with mandarin oranges, and chill in the refrigerator for about 15 minutes to finish.

Common Mistakes and How to Avoid Them

[Mistake 1: The whipped cream sags] If you put whipped cream on a hot pancake, it will melt and collapse. The golden rule is to always let the pancake cool completely first.


[Mistake 2: Watery Texture] If you serve the pancakes without draining the syrup thoroughly, they’ll end up soggy. The trick is to transfer only the amount you’ll use to a colander and let the excess liquid drain off.

A Quick Tip for Making It Taste Great

When making pancakes, making them a little smaller gives them more of a “cake-like” feel and makes them look cute. If you mix just a little mandarin orange syrup into the cream, it brings the whole dish together and makes it taste much better.
